Simple Sauteed Okra


 

Okra is also called Lady's Fingers.  In Hindi, it is called Bhindi.

Hate fried okra? Try this simple recipe.

 

1 lb. fresh Okra pods

1 tblsp. Olive oil

1 tsp. cumin powder

Salt, to taste

Freshly ground black pepper, to taste

 

1) Wash and completely dry okra pods. Slice okra into match sticks or rounds.

2) In a non-stick pan, heat the oil. Add the sliced okra in a single layer in the pan. Cook for 10-12 minutes turning the pieces every 2-3 minutes until golden brown.

3) Sprinkle the cumin powder, salt and pepper. Cook for another 2-3 minutes or until the cumin is aromatic. 

4) Remove from heat and serve. Makes 4 side dish portions.

 

Notes:

The secret to crispy, not-gummy okra is to dry the pods completely before slicing them.

DH likes okra that is almost burnt, so I cook it about 20 minutes.
